1. Networking Mastery: Stand Out and Connect

In a world where 85% of job offers come from internal referrals, building a robust professional network is crucial. Learn how to network effectively, schedule daily calls, and increase your chances of getting that coveted referral.

2. Build a Functioning Product: Showcase Your Skills

Discover the power of hands-on experience by building a functioning product. Whether you're a product manager, designer, or software engineer, this tactic not only demonstrates your passion but also sets you apart from the competition.

3. Case Studies: Tailor Your Approach to Specific Companies

Create personalized case studies for the companies you're applying to. By showcasing your problem-solving skills within the context of a company's challenges, you'll impress hiring managers and increase your chances of landing interviews.

4. Learn Cross-Disciplinary Skills: Think Beyond Your Role

Explore the benefits of acquiring skills beyond your primary role. For software engineers, understanding product considerations and business impact can make you more appealing. Product managers can enhance collaboration by learning coding basics or design principles.
